How Bone Char Targets Fluoride Chemistry at Home Flow Rates

The crystalline hydroxyapatite structure in bone char media has a natural affinity for fluoride; under typical pH ranges (6.5–8.5), fluoride replaces hydroxyl groups on the surface. That’s the core mechanism. But in homes with Chloramine, organics, and trace metals, capacity can plummet if upstream polishing is weak. SoftPro’s catalytic carbon stage pre-conditions the water by breaking chloramine bonds and reducing dissolved organics, allowing the bone char to focus on fluoride instead of getting fouled. The result: higher usable capacity per pound of media and more reliable day-to-day performance across variable flow rates, sinks, showers, and laundry cycles.

Activated Alumina for pH Resilience and Late-Bed Stability

As pH migrates upward, fluoride adsorption can weaken. Activated alumina mitigates this by providing robust adsorption sites that hold performance across a broader pH spectrum. In homes running 7.6–8.4 pH—common in the Southwest—this stability becomes the safety net that keeps end-of-life readings from creeping up. Parents don’t have to micromanage pH or worry about school-morning surprises.

Ion Exchange Resin as a Precision Polisher

Fluoride isn’t the only anion in your water. Bicarbonate, sulfate, and others compete for adsorption sites. A carefully selected ion exchange resin mops up what slips past, acting as a final assurance stage. This polisher is why SoftPro can hit sub-0.1 mg/L post-treatment readings late into the media’s lifespan, not just on day one. For formula prep and cooking, that margin matters.

Why Health-Effect Standards Outrank Aesthetic Claims

Aesthetic standards (like NSF 42) cover taste and odor; they matter, but they won’t tell you whether fluoride is actually reduced to safe levels across time. NSF 53 for fluoride ties claims to measured reductions at controlled conditions. SoftPro’s reliance on NSF 53 data means the number you see is the number you get, even under less-than-ideal household scenarios.

Right-Sizing the Tank to Protect Contact Time

Tank diameter and bed depth govern the residence time water spends contacting bone char media and activated alumina. Oversizing kills pressure, undersizing kills reduction. We balance both by aligning expected peak flows with media kinetics, ensuring fluoride molecules “see” enough active sites even on laundry-and-shower mornings.

Install Space, Bypass, and Service Access

Every install should leave 18–24 inches of overhead clearance for media service, clean unions for easy disconnection, and a full-port bypass for emergencies. SoftPro kits include the right valves and ports so a plumber isn’t inventing solutions on site. That’s how you avoid the 11 pm “we can’t shut it off” call.

How does SoftPro’s bone char media remove fluoride compared to standard activated carbon?

Standard activated carbon adsorbs organics and improves taste/odor but has very limited fluoride affinity—often under 15% removal and inconsistent across pH ranges. Bone char media, made from calcium-phosphate structures, exchanges hydroxyl groups with fluoride ions and adsorbs them onto micro-porous surfaces. It’s a mechanism tailored to fluoride chemistry, not a side effect. SoftPro enhances this by placing catalytic carbon first to break down Chloramine and reduce organics, protecting bone char sites. We often follow with activated alumina for additional fluoride-specific capacity and pH resilience. The result is high removal (94–97% under NSF 53 testing) at real household flow rates. This multi-stage path turns fluoride reduction from a hope into a measured result.

Should I choose whole-house SoftPro or an under-sink reverse osmosis system?

A high-quality reverse osmosis system under the sink can produce low-fluoride drinking water at one tap, but it won’t touch showers, bathrooms, or kitchen activities that don’t use that faucet. RO also wastes water (typically 2–3 gallons per gallon produced, sometimes more) and requires semi-annual filter changes. SoftPro’s whole-house approach reduces fluoride everywhere without the waste stream and with far less maintenance, covering formula prep at any sink, spontaneous cooking, and bath-time sips. Many families pair SoftPro with a polishing RO at the kitchen for ultra-low TDS cooking water.
